Which apps help best to find free charging stations?

Stiftung Warentest has tested it - and makes clear recommendations.

The big tour with the electric car is still considered an adventure for many.

A lot can happen on the road:

from a blocked charging plug to an odyssey in the search for charging stations, the journey may have one or two surprises in store.

However, finding free charging points should no longer be a problem – if you have installed the right app.

Ideally, this not only reveals where

there are columns

on the route or at the destination , but also how many of the charging points there belong to the 90 percent intact electricity donors and

are free

(although the latter can of course change while you are using them controls).

The amperage is also displayed: If you are only looking for fast direct current with at least 200 kilowatts, you can filter the search accordingly.

The apps usually come from the network operators themselves, usually also allow payment by smartphone - and ideally also show the locations of the competition.

But not all help equally well, according to the conclusion of the Stiftung Warentest, which tested 20 charging apps from ten providers during five test drives in the city, in the country and on the motorways.

The search function, the correctness of the information, user-friendliness and data protection were evaluated.

None of the mini-programs achieved the top rating

of “very good”

.

It is remarkable who is missing from the list of the best: Ionity of all things, the

flagship network of the German car

companies BMW, Mercedes-Benz, Volkswagen and Ford as well as the Korean providers Hyundai and Kia, only manages an “adequate” app according to the testers, and is at the bottom of the

ranking

.

The testers criticized the lack of information about the charging point and the fact that it only shows its own charging options, especially those installed along the freeways.
